Output bf16bb66d2e495b72181a07c176a7eced8cb29b730f7a644c24adfc75b91bb5d:26

value
2907000
script pubkey
OP_0 OP_PUSHBYTES_20 27a4c34c5abcc76f51c8a83c940539b178175405
address
bc1qy7jvxnz6hnrk75wg4q7fgpfek9upw4q9nanrg2
transaction
bf16bb66d2e495b72181a07c176a7eced8cb29b730f7a644c24adfc75b91bb5d
spent
true